Castle Flowers
01926 851410
Here at Buds & Bows, we understand the impact that a bouquet of beautiful, fresh flowers can have on someone, no matter what message you want to convey. With all of flowers delivered directly from the Dutch Flower Auctions on a daily basis, we can assure the finest quality gifts and most competitive prices in Kenilworth.